Subject: Re: kern/35351 (Re: CVS commit: src/sys/kern)
To: None <kern-bug-people@netbsd.org, gnats-admin@netbsd.org,>
From: Elad Efrat <e@murder.org>
List: netbsd-bugs
Date: 04/07/2007 09:40:02
The following reply was made to PR kern/35351; it has been noted by GNATS.
From: Elad Efrat <e@murder.org>
To: YAMAMOTO Takashi <yamt@mwd.biglobe.ne.jp>
Cc: rmind@NetBSD.org, source-changes@NetBSD.org, core@netbsd.org,
gnats-bugs@netbsd.org
Subject: Re: kern/35351 (Re: CVS commit: src/sys/kern)
Date: Sat, 07 Apr 2007 12:36:35 +0200
YAMAMOTO Takashi wrote:
> [ add gnats cc: ]
>
>> YAMAMOTO Takashi wrote:
>>>> the reason fileassoc lacked locking primitives is that I waited for
>>>> ad@ to commit and stablize newlock2. I *discussed* this pr with ad@
>>>> and yamt@, and, as a matter of fact, *prior* to newlock2, in a biglock
>>>> kernel, it is impossible to trigger the NULL deref.
>>> i've explained you that the PR is not (necessarily) about MP.
>>> did you understand it?
>>>
>>> (i'm not talking about this particular instance of NULL dereference.
>>> i'm not interested in analyzing how the known to be broken code can behave.
>>> i merely want to make sure that you know about the problem. if you already
>>> know, it's fine.)
>> I know.
>>
>> -e.
>
> ok, then you mean not to fix it for netbsd-4?
>
> YAMAMOTO Takashi
no, sorry. it's not a problem for netbsd-4.
-e.